Overview of Body Cavities
Body cavities are hollow spaces within the human body that house and protect vital organs. They allow organs to expand, contract, and move without friction or damage. The primary purpose of these cavities is to provide structural organization and facilitate proper physiological functioning. Understanding the different body cavities is crucial for fields such as anatomy, physiology, and medicine. The study of body cavities also helps in diagnosing illnesses and planning surgical interventions.
Definition and Importance
Body cavities are defined as fluid-filled or air-filled spaces inside the body that contain organs and organ systems. These cavities are lined by membranes that reduce friction and provide protection. The importance of body cavities lies in their role as protective chambers and as spaces that allow organs to maintain their shape and position. Additionally, cavities contribute to the overall homeostasis of the body.
Types of Body Cavities
The human body primarily contains two major cavity groups: the dorsal cavity and the ventral cavity. Each of these can be further divided into smaller cavities that house specific organs. The dorsal cavity primarily contains the central nervous system, while the ventral cavity contains organs involved in respiration, digestion, circulation, and reproduction.
Major Body Cavities and Their Subdivisions
There are two main body cavities: the dorsal cavity and the ventral cavity. Each has important subdivisions that are commonly referenced in body cavities practice worksheet answers. Understanding these subdivisions is key to identifying organ locations and functions.
Dorsal Cavity
The dorsal cavity is located along the posterior side of the body and is divided into two main parts: the cranial cavity and the spinal cavity.
- Cranial Cavity: Houses the brain and is protected by the skull.
- Spinal Cavity: Encloses the spinal cord within the vertebral column.
Ventral Cavity
The ventral cavity is the larger, anterior cavity and is divided into the thoracic cavity and the abdominopelvic cavity.
- Thoracic Cavity: Contains the lungs, heart, esophagus, and trachea. It is further divided into the pleural cavities (lungs) and the pericardial cavity (heart).
- Abdominopelvic Cavity: Subdivided into the abdominal cavity, which contains digestive organs, and the pelvic cavity, which contains the bladder, reproductive organs, and rectum.
Structures Contained Within Each Cavity
Knowing the organs and structures contained within each body cavity is critical for completing body cavities practice worksheet answers accurately. This knowledge also supports understanding of how different organ systems interact.
Contents of the Cranial and Spinal Cavities
The cranial cavity primarily contains the brain, including the cerebrum, cerebellum, and brainstem. The spinal cavity houses the spinal cord, which is a continuation of the brainstem and is protected by vertebrae and meninges.
Contents of the Thoracic Cavity
The thoracic cavity includes vital organs such as:
- The heart, enclosed within the pericardial cavity.
- The lungs, each within its own pleural cavity.
- The esophagus and trachea, which pass through the mediastinum, the central compartment of the thoracic cavity.
Contents of the Abdominopelvic Cavity
The abdominopelvic cavity contains numerous organs involved in digestion, excretion, and reproduction:
- Abdominal Cavity: Stomach, liver, pancreas, spleen, gallbladder, intestines, kidneys.
- Pelvic Cavity: Urinary bladder, reproductive organs (uterus, ovaries in females; prostate in males), rectum.
Common Questions and Answers in Body Cavities Practice Worksheets
Body cavities practice worksheets typically include questions that test knowledge of cavity locations, organ contents, and functions. Below are examples of common questions with their corresponding answers.
Sample Question 1: Identify the cavity housing the heart.
Answer: The heart is housed in the pericardial cavity, which is part of the thoracic cavity within the ventral body cavity.
Sample Question 2: Which cavity contains the brain?
Answer: The brain is contained within the cranial cavity, a subdivision of the dorsal body cavity.
Sample Question 3: Name the organs found in the abdominal cavity.
Answer: The abdominal cavity contains the stomach, liver, pancreas, spleen, gallbladder, intestines, and kidneys.
Sample Question 4: What separates the thoracic cavity from the abdominopelvic cavity?
Answer: The diaphragm, a muscular structure, separates the thoracic cavity from the abdominopelvic cavity.
